Solution for c^2+9c+8=0 equation:


Simplifying
c2 + 9c + 8 = 0

Reorder the terms:
8 + 9c + c2 = 0

Solving
8 + 9c + c2 = 0

Solving for variable 'c'.

Factor a trinomial.
(8 + c)(1 + c) = 0

Subproblem 1

Set the factor '(8 + c)' equal to zero and attempt to solve: Simplifying 8 + c = 0 Solving 8 + c = 0 Move all terms containing c to the left, all other terms to the right. Add '-8' to each side of the equation. 8 + -8 + c = 0 + -8 Combine like terms: 8 + -8 = 0 0 + c = 0 + -8 c = 0 + -8 Combine like terms: 0 + -8 = -8 c = -8 Simplifying c = -8

Subproblem 2

Set the factor '(1 + c)' equal to zero and attempt to solve: Simplifying 1 + c = 0 Solving 1 + c = 0 Move all terms containing c to the left, all other terms to the right. Add '-1' to each side of the equation. 1 + -1 + c = 0 + -1 Combine like terms: 1 + -1 = 0 0 + c = 0 + -1 c = 0 + -1 Combine like terms: 0 + -1 = -1 c = -1 Simplifying c = -1

Solution

c = {-8, -1}
